Specification & Description

Specification Description
Part Number ASISAFEMON2
Manufacturer Schneider
Category Safety Automation
Family ASIS
Description Schneider Interface Safety Module 24 V dc AS-Interface Relay
Short Description AS-Interface Safety at work monitor
Weight (kg) 0.450
Commodity Code 853710
Product or Component Type AS-Interface Safety at work monitor
Actuator Sensor Interface Profile [AS-i] 7.F
Specific Application For basic monitoring of safety devices
Number of Safety Circuits 2 NO + 2 NO
Discrete Output Number 2
Output Type Solid state
Rated Supply Voltage [Us] 24 V DC (+/- 15 %)
Current Consumption 44 mA AS-Interface line
Rated Operational Current [Ie] 0.2 A
Response Time < 40 ms
Pick Up Duration < 10000 ms
Input Type Opto-electronic coupler, 10 mA at 24 V for protection control function
Discrete Output Type PNP transistor output(s), 0.2 mA
Protection Type External fuse
Associated Fuse Rating <= 4 A
Enclosure Material Polyamide PA66
Fixing Mode Clip-on, mounting on symmetrical DIN rail conforming to EN 50022
Local Signalling 2 LEDs green, function: AS-Interface line supply; 2 LEDs green, function: safety outputs closed; 2 LEDs red, function: AS-Interface line fault; 2 LEDs red, function: safety outputs open (on steady) or output error (flashing); 2 LEDs yellow, function: restart signal
Product Weight 0.45 kg
Standards EN 574, EN 954-1 category 4, IEC 61508, EN 50295, ISO 13849-1 category 4, EN/IEC 61496-1

The Schneider ASISAFEMON2 is a robust and reliable Safety at Work Monitor, designed to enhance the safety and efficiency of your industrial automation processes. This module is part of Schneider's esteemed ASIS family and operates with a rated supply voltage of 24 V DC. It features an opto-electronic coupler for protection control and start functions, ensuring seamless operation. The module is equipped with two safety circuits and two discrete outputs, providing a comprehensive safety solution for your automation needs. The ASISAFEMON2 is designed for basic monitoring of safety devices, making it an essential component in maintaining a safe and productive work environment. Its solid-state output type and polyamide PA66 enclosure material ensure durability and longevity. The module also includes local signalling with multiple LEDs for easy monitoring of its status. With its clip-on fixing mode, the ASISAFEMON2 is easy to install on a symmetrical DIN rail conforming to EN 50022.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main function of this safety module?

The Schneider Interface Safety Module is designed for basic monitoring of safety devices. It's an essential component in safety automation systems.

What type of output does this module have?

This module has a solid state output type. It also features PNP transistor output(s), with a rated operational current of 0.2 A.

What is the rated supply voltage for this module?

The rated supply voltage for this Schneider Interface Safety Module is 24 V DC (+/- 15 %).

What is the response time of this module?

The response time of this module is less than 40 ms, making it highly responsive in safety automation systems.

What is the weight of this module?

The Schneider Interface Safety Module weighs 0.45 kg.

What material is the enclosure made of?

The enclosure of this module is made of Polyamide PA66, known for its durability and resistance to wear and tear.

What are the environmental standards this module complies with?

This module complies with several environmental standards including EN 574, EN 954-1 category 4, IEC 61508, EN 50295, ISO 13849-1 category 4, and EN/IEC 61496-1.

What is the fixing mode of this module?

This module can be fixed via clip-on, mounting on a symmetrical DIN rail conforming to EN 50022.

What is the current consumption of this module?

The current consumption of this module is 44 mA on the AS-Interface line.

What are the local signalling features of this module?

The module features local signalling with 2 green LEDs for AS-Interface line supply and safety outputs closed, 2 red LEDs for AS-Interface line fault and safety outputs open or output error, and 2 yellow LEDs for restart signal.
